The Venue
- Canvas Hotel, Dallas sits just south of downtown in the Cedars District—an industrial-chic area with a growing arts and nightlife scene.
- The hotel channels a bold, creative vibe with rotating art, warehouse-style rooms, a rooftop pool with skyline views, and a bar that fills up with locals by sunset.
- It’s not in the gay district but feels connected to the city’s creative pulse.
- From the gay district (Oak Lawn): By taxi/rideshare: Around 10 minutes, depending on traffic.
- By public transport: Bus 031 or DART Light Rail from Oak Lawn (transfer downtown), about 30–40 minutes total.

Texans are proud to say that everything is bigger in the Lone Star State. One visit to “The Strip,” the center of gay life along Cedar Springs Road, and you will see what we mean. The nightlife venues are gargantuan! Every place has at least one outdoor patio.
